Jamuniya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Jamuniya Village has a population of 369 (369) with 199 (199) males and 170 (170) females.The sex ratio in Jamuniya is 855,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Jamuniya Village is 73 (73) which is 19.78% of Jamuniya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Jamuniya Village is 623 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Jamuniya village is listed as part of the Gadarwara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Narsimhapur District in the state of MADHYA PRADESH in INDIA.

Jamuniya Literacy Rate
Jamuniya Village has a literacy rate of 69.59%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Jamuniya Village is 79.87 lower than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Jamuniya Village is 58.45 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Jamuniya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Jamuniya Village is 61 (61) with 29 (29) males and 32 (32) females, which is 16.53% of Jamuniya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 1104 females for every 1000 males.
Jamuniya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Jamuniya Village is 38 (38) with 20 (20) males and 18 (18) females, which is 10.3% of Jamuniya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 900 females for every 1000 males.

Jamuniya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Jamuniya Village, there are about 215 (215) workers, making up nearly 58.27% of the Jamuniya Village total population. Out of these, around 115 (115) are male workers, and about 100 (100) are female workers.
